1. What is mlc?
The pump head, measured in mlc, is an abbreviation for "meter liquid column" in English, meaning meter liquid column. The head of a centrifugal pump, also known as the head, measures the effective energy obtained per unit weight of liquid after passing through the pump. It is an important working parameter of the pump, also known as the head. This parameter can be expressed as an increase in the pressure energy head, kinetic energy head, and potential energy head of the fluid. In the conversion of pressure units, 1mlc is equal to 0.01 megapascals, which is an important conversion relationship that helps us to more accurately understand and use this unit.
